35 yr old female my period always regular 25 to 28 days... last month my period was on 45 th day and had bleeding for 4 days... this month my period is on 26 th day for first two days period bleeding was normal from 3 rd to 5 th day flow was less and getting dark brown medium size clots during standing and sitting for pee... today 6 th day sometime flow is there sometimes no flow sometimes small clots coming while standing

A. Hey! While an occasional variation in cycle length can happen due to routine factors like high stress, illness or acute lifestyle changes, a pattern of a highly delayed cycle followed by unusual, bloody behaviour should actually be assessed by your doctor. So getting in touch with your consulting gynaecologist to guide you further is important.
